RULES a) Passive infinitive or -ing form
He is always being stopped by police just for the way he looks.
bắt đầu học
Use the passive infinitive or -ing form to talk about actions which are done to the subject.
RULES b) Perfect infinitive or -ing form
They seem to have forgotten why we came here.
bắt đầu học
Use the perfect infinitive or -ing form to emphasise when one action happens before another.
RULES c) Negative infinitive or -ing form
Not understanding people's reasons for why they do the things they do is a big problem.
bắt đầu học
Negatives infinitives or -ing forms can often be made the subject of a sentence, like gerunds.
